Ecological Barriers
Physical, chemical, or biological factors in the environment that prevent species from dispersing to certain areas, limiting their distribution.
Biological Barriers
Structures and mechanisms that protect organisms from pathogens, toxins, and other external threats.
Energetic Barriers
The energy obstacles that must be overcome for a chemical reaction to proceed, related to the activation energy of the reaction.
Postzygotic Barriers
Reproductive barriers that occur after fertilization, preventing successful development, survival, or reproduction of hybrid offspring.
